Vue 2.0 高级实战 开发移动端音乐WebApp--笔记
1.3个没用过的插件 “babel-runtime”: “^6.0.0”, “fastclick”: “^1.0.6” 所有的点击没有300毫秒的延迟 移动设备上的浏览器默认会在用户点击屏幕大约延迟300毫秒后才会触发点击事件,这是为了检查用户是否在做双击。为了能够立即响应用户的点击事件,才有了FastClick。 “babel-polyfill”: “^6.2.0”, 用来实现es6的转换 vue-lazyload 图片懒加载,节约资源 2.最新版vuejs没有dev-server.js 方法:修改webpack.dev.conf.js中的代码 1.前面先定义一下 const axios = require(‘axios’) 2.在devServer中添加一个before方法 3.右侧垂直方向居中 水平方向居中 align-items:center 垂直方向居中 flex-direction: column justify-content:center 4.fastclick和better-click冲突 添加一个needsclick的类,图片就可以被点击 5.prefixStyle()函数使用 操作css3的一些属性,为了浏览器的兼容性,我们需要添加一些前缀。 如果写在css样式中,编辑器自带的功能一般可以实现,或者通过gulp,webpack打包时也都有插件实现自动添加